Emotion and chaos are level four and five, respectively. You can buy them from the adventure mart or the scroll seller above the seven vales, and Aerie should have at least one memorisation in fifth circle spells. If she doesn't, ditch her and get anyone else. : )

You get him at some point in Renal Bloodscalp's quest. He's evil, but like I've said, the only difference alignment makes on how an NPC views the party is that they'll leave if your rep gets too high/low. Edwin will hang around 'till your reputation tops eighteen.
